KEGG   ENZYME: 1.21.3.1
Entry
EC 1.21.3.1                 Enzyme                                 
Name
isopenicillin-N synthase;
isopenicillin N synthetase
Class
Oxidoreductases;
Catalysing the reaction X-H + Y-H = X-Y;
With oxygen as acceptor
Sysname
N-[(5S)-5-amino-5-carboxypentanoyl]-L-cysteinyl-D-valine:oxygen oxidoreductase (cyclizing)
Reaction(IUBMB)
N-[(5S)-5-amino-5-carboxypentanoyl]-L-cysteinyl-D-valine + O2 = isopenicillin N + 2 H2O
Reaction(KEGG)
(other) R04872
Substrate
N-[(5S)-5-amino-5-carboxypentanoyl]-L-cysteinyl-D-valine;
O2 [CPD:C00007]
Product
isopenicillin N [CPD:C05557];
H2O [CPD:C00001]
Comment
Forms part of the penicillin biosynthesis pathway (for pathway, click here).
